The service
Provio helps businesses understand their online reputation. You provide your business name and Google Place ID; we import your Google and TripAdvisor reviews via a bulk import (not automatic real-time syncing), calculate a reputation score, and generate AI-powered insights and draft reply suggestions.
Provio is provided “as is”. We're a small, evolving product — features may change, and we don't guarantee the service will always be available or error-free.

AI-generated content
Provio uses AI to generate insights and draft review replies. These are suggestions, not guaranteed accurate — the AI can misread tone, get details wrong, or draft something that doesn't fit your voice. You're responsible for reviewing, editing and approving anything before you post it publicly. Provio doesn't publish replies on your behalf.
